Routine home maintenance doesn’t require professional landscaper tools. Gas-powered trimmers may use a throttle response for quick-powered adjustments when tough weeds or thick growth need tending. On battery-powered models, there may be two speed controls-one to increase the power for use on thicker/overgrown areas and the other to lower the power to trim perimeters while extending battery life. Some trimmers have variable speed controls for different cutting conditions. A thicker line of 0.08- or 0.095-inch is more durable and increases the cutting power. The thinnest line is 0.065 of an inch it’s used for lighter-duty work, generally with smaller cordless or electric trimmers. The type of string used in each trimmer contributes to how efficiently the trimmer cuts down the grass, weeds, or overgrown areas. To get the job done faster, string trimmers with dual heads can cut more efficiently than single-string trimmers. Overextending the line length for a larger cutting width reduces the efficiency of the trimmer, as the engine has to spin more weight than its design intended. For an increased cutting swath, choose a trimmer with a long line rather than manually overextending the line length during use. Choosing the right width helps users get their grass trimming done quickly and efficiently. Most models have a pull-start.Ĭutting width, or cutting swath, is the diameter of the trimmer. These trimmers may require a mix of gas and oil to operate and occasional maintenance.

  • Gas-powered trimmers are more robust and are best for tougher jobs because they offer more power than electric string trimmers.
  • Depending on lawn size, a backup battery may be needed to finish a job. These turn on with a switch and are a handy choice for low-maintenance lawns.
  • Battery-powered trimmers are more maneuverable than corded trimmers.
  • Low maintenance and reliable power are these trimmers’ strongest features. This type is reliable for small yards with an accessible outlet where the cord can reach all areas of the lawn to ensure a complete job.
  • Corded electric trimmers are lightweight and turn on with a switch.
  • String trimmers also can be grouped depending on whether they are corded electric, battery powered, or gas powered:
  • Cordless trimmers are either gas- or battery-powered, giving the user freedom to use the trimmer anywhere in the yard.
  • They provide an unlimited power source and don’t require refueling or battery replacement.
  • Corded trimmers require an extension cord and a power outlet.
  • String trimmers are classified as either corded or cordless: These considerations can help reveal which string trimmer is the best string trimmer for each user’s situation.
